The Process of Obtaining a Driver's License in Denmark
Obtaining a motorist's license in Denmark is a structured process that includes multiple actions. Below is a list of the primary stages included:
Eligibility Check:
- Must be at least 17 years old to apply for a student's permit.
- Need to pass a medical checkup to guarantee fitness to drive.
Enrolment in a Driving School:
- Choose a licensed driving school.
- Total a series of theoretical and useful lessons.
Theory Exam:
- Pass a written test that covers traffic laws, signs, and safe driving practices.
Driving Test:
- After completing the needed hours of behind-the-wheel training, candidates should pass a useful driving test.
Issuance of the Driver's License:
- Upon effective conclusion of both exams, the candidate can look for a chauffeur's license through the Danish Driving Authority.
Table of Costs Associated with Obtaining a Driver's License
The table below sums up the average expenses connected with getting a motorist's license in Denmark:
Expense Type
Approximated Cost (DKK)
Driving School Fees
10,000 – 15,000
Theory Exam Fee
450 – 600
Driving Test Fee
600 – 900
Medical exam
300 – 500
Overall Estimated Cost
11,350 – 16,500
Note: Costs might vary based on driving school and individual circumstances.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. What kinds of motorist's licenses are readily available in Denmark?
Denmark problems numerous kinds of motorist's licenses, consisting of:
- Category B: For basic passenger lorries.
- Category A: For motorbikes.
- Classification C: For heavy lorries.
- Classification D: For buses.
2. Can I utilize my foreign chauffeur's license in Denmark?
Yes, visitors can use their foreign chauffeur's licenses in Denmark for up to 90 days. After that, you should acquire a Danish chauffeur's license if you plan to remain longer.
3. What takes Dansk Kørekort if I fail the driving test?
If you fail the driving test, you can retake it. You'll require to book another test date through the Danish Driving Authority, and there might be extra costs involved.
4. Are there any age constraints for obtaining a driver's license?
Yes, you need to be at least:
- 17 years old for a Category B license (cars and trucks).
- 18 years old for a Category A license (bikes).
- 21 years old for a Category C license (heavy lorries).
5. What driving constraints apply to new motorists?
New motorists in Denmark should observe specific restrictions, such as a probationary duration of 3 years. Throughout this time, they need to stick to a zero-tolerance policy for alcohol and may deal with more stringent charges for traffic offenses.
